3D Printing in Dental Surgery
To enhance the area of oral surgery, you can explore the subtopic of 3D printing in oral surgery. This cutting-edge technology has the potential to transform the method oral cosmetic surgeons run and treat individuals. Here are 4 crucial methods which 3D printing is forming the field:
- ** Custom-made Surgical Guides **: 3D printing enables the creation of very precise and patient-specific surgical guides, enhancing the precision and performance of treatments.
- ** Implant Prosthetics **: With 3D printing, dental cosmetic surgeons can develop customized dental implant prosthetics that flawlessly fit a patient's one-of-a-kind anatomy, causing much better results and client complete satisfaction.
- ** Bone Grafting **: 3D printing allows the production of patient-specific bone grafts, lowering the need for standard grafting methods and enhancing healing and recovery time.
- ** Education and Training **: 3D printing can be utilized to produce sensible surgical designs for instructional functions, permitting dental cosmetic surgeons to exercise complicated treatments prior to performing them on clients.
With its prospective to boost accuracy, customization, and training, 3D printing is an amazing growth in the field of oral surgery.
Minimally Intrusive Strategies
To even more progress the area of dental surgery, embrace the potential of minimally intrusive methods that can greatly profit both surgeons and people alike.
Minimally intrusive strategies are changing the area by lowering surgical trauma, reducing post-operative pain, and accelerating the recuperation procedure. These strategies include utilizing smaller sized lacerations and specialized tools to perform procedures with accuracy and effectiveness.
By utilizing advanced imaging technology, such as cone light beam computed tomography (CBCT), cosmetic surgeons can properly intend and execute surgeries with minimal invasiveness.
